How Can We Protect HIV Patients’ Data Privacy?

The unintentional disclosure of HIV statuses following the Central YMCA data breach underscores the precarious state of health information privacy. This incident has propelled the subject of protecting personal health data, particularly for those living with HIV, into the spotlight. Considering the social stigmas and discrimination still facing many with the disease, there is an urgent need to safeguard their sensitive information with greater vigilance.

Understanding the Scope of the Problem

The Consequences of a Data Breach

The impact of a data breach extends far beyond the initial shock and embarrassment of having one’s private health information exposed. For individuals with HIV, this exposure can lead to social ostracization, discrimination in the workplace, and severe psychological trauma. While the ICO’s decision to impose a reduced fine on Central YMCA hints at a lenient approach toward public sector organizations, it also ignites a debate about the effectiveness of such penalties. A nuanced understanding of these consequences is critical in designing penalties that are substantial enough to deter future lapses in data privacy.

Trends in Health Sector Data Breaches

Health sector data breaches are alarmingly widespread. The ICO has reported recurrent failures to protect sensitive health data, underlining a systemic issue within healthcare communication practices. A disturbing trend has emerged where the health sector, as reported by the ICO, is disproportionately susceptible to breaches, accounting for over one-fifth of all incidents within the 2022/2023 period. This pattern points to a need for a reevaluation of current data handling protocols and a shift towards a culture that prioritizes patient privacy.

Mitigating Risks in Digital Communication

The Importance of Proper Email Protocols

Frequent missteps in email communication, such as the neglectful use of BCC, are leading causes of data breaches. Best practices in digital correspondence serve as the first line of defense against unintentional data exposure. Adherence to these protocols, while seemingly basic, remains a critical factor in preventing security lapses. The ICO’s incident records expose a persistent neglect for such basic yet crucial practices among organizations, signaling an immediate need for reinforcing email protocol education.
